Synopsis
This visual essay explores the notion of "minimum"--a concept which is rooted in the pursuit of simplicity--as applied to architecture, art, and design., A unique book that presents a wide range of images embodying the idea of reduction to a minimum to achieve clarity and simplicity, an idea which has pervaded in the conception and design of objects and buildings for millennia. The book both embodies and presents a sequence of ideas that have influenced John Pawson and other artists in their search for simplicity., Clarity through austerity was the byword of minimalist design in architecture and this book embodies and presents the ideas that have influenced John Pawson and other artists in their search for simplicity.
